  7. Have you checked that it isn't something silly like the top cap bolts being abit loose? The hole is a breather hole for the diaphram so that it can move up and down with the fluid level in the reservoir and keep the fluid sealed. Like said, a new diaphram and bleed should do the trick.

    Brake Pad

    Stick them in the oven, Then turn the oven on to about 200 degrees and by the time it gets up to temperature, the bond should be broken and the pad should peel out with not too much difficulty. If not... stick them back in the oven for a minuite.

  17. Mikee

    Echo Tr

    My bro has the TR wheel on his blade with the same drop outs and yeh with out the snail cams it does fit. One problem we faced though is that because the TR hub body is quite wide you might find that the chain or sprocket will hit the drop outs. We solved this by using the Echo TR sprocket which has the teeth in the middle and the sprocket and it now clears nicley with a 18:12 gear ratio.
